SSA Marine is seeking a Manager, Commercial Services, Terminals & Stevedoring to join our team! This full-time, permanent position is based at our office in North Vancouver and will report to the Vice President, Business Development & Commercial.

The Position

The Manager, Commercial Services - Terminals & Stevedoring drives revenue growth and business development by optimizing commercial opportunities, managing key customer and stakeholder relationships, and supporting operational performance within the Terminals & Stevedore Division. The role oversees stevedore quotations, billing, invoice approvals, and contract negotiations while collaborating across operations, finance, and commercial teams to maximize cargo volumes and support sustainable business growth.

You will be part of a motivated and diverse team and will have a high degree of interaction with all employees throughout the organization.

Responsibilities & Activities

  • Coordinate and support annual stevedore agreement negotiations to achieve commercial objectives.
  • Collaborate with operations, finance, and commercial teams to align business activities with operational and financial goals.
  • Develop and maintain strategic relationships with carriers, ship agents, freight forwarders, project management firms, and other key industry stakeholders.
  • Foster positive relationships with local stakeholders and internal business units to support effective coordination and execution.
  • Identify, develop, and retain new business opportunities to support revenue growth and market expansion.
  • Drive initiatives to increase cargo volumes, strengthen customer retention, and enhance the Division’s market share.
  • Prepare reports and presentations for senior leadership on business opportunities, pipeline performance, and market developments.
  • Conduct market and competitive analysis, monitor industry trends, and provide insights and recommendations to support strategic planning and commercial decision-making.

Qualifications & Skills

The Manager communicates and collaborates with internal teams and external stakeholders, including carriers, ship agents, freight forwarders, and community partners, to support commercial activities, business development, and relationship management. The role prepares and presents commercial analyses, quotes, and reports, while providing recommendations to leadership on market, operational, and business opportunities. Primarily office-based, the position requires frequent stakeholder engagement, strong attention to detail, and the ability to manage multiple priorities, with occasional travel, terminal site visits, and attendance at meetings or events outside regular business hours.

The qualifications and skills to be successful in this position include:

  • Industry-related qualifications with a minimum of 10 years of management-level experience in the marine, logistics, or transportation sector.
  • Strong knowledge of marine logistics, terminal operations, and marine operational processes.
  • Experience with commercial functions including rate analysis, pricing, quotations, billing, and contract management.
  • Thorough understanding of market conditions, competitive landscapes, and business growth opportunities.
  • Strong analytical and business acumen with the ability to assess costs, revenue drivers, and commercial opportunities.
  • Excellent relationship management, stakeholder engagement, communication, and negotiation skills.
  • High attention to detail with proficiency in Microsoft Office, particularly Excel, and other business systems.
  • Proven ability to balance operational and business development priorities, manage multiple demands, collaborate across functions, and apply market insights to business decisions.
